In our EL.NET control system, digital E+L components connect together consistently in a network and in this way make possible straightforward, quick integration into the customer's network. EL.NET also allows easy integration of sensors of other brands used by the customer. All devices automatically and selectively exchange data relevant for optimal control within a production plant.

With EL.NET, up to 255 control systems can be connected together in a network. Here, the data acquired at all levels of the production process makes up a decisive part of the automation. This data creates high levels of transparency and makes it possible to monitor processes in real time, to optimize them, and to therefore minimize downtimes and production waste.

 

Every EL.NET device is equipped with an integrated web server, which is used to share data and functions. This enables user-friendly, guided commissioning, optimization, and service via web-based management, i.e. using a common standard web browser – without any need for dedicated software. The EL.NET components comprise our digital edge and color line sensors, controllers, and brushless – and therefore wear-free – actuating drives. Cabling and power supplies to the devices are provided via PoE, which is a very simple solution. Commissioning is also quick and trouble-free via plug & play.

The components flexibly adapt to new requirements, minimize retooling times, and thus guarantee efficient production. Integrated fieldbus interfaces and optional fieldbus modules make the process of connecting E+L control systems to a customer controller a straightforward task.
